How It Works: Free Pizza, Fire Safety Style

Here’s the deal: when you order from participating Domino’s stores, firefighters may arrive with a fire engine right along with your delivery. If your smoke alarms are working properly, your pizza is on the house. Not working? Don’t worry, the firefighters will replace batteries or install fully functioning smoke alarms to keep your home safe. Either way, it’s a win for both your stomach and your safety.

This exciting partnership between Domino’s, the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A), and local fire departments has been a beloved tradition for 18 years, spreading fire safety awareness in neighborhoods across the country.

Fire Prevention Week: Safety Tips That Could Earn You Pizza

Domino’s and NFPA are also using this week to highlight a critical home safety topic: lithium-ion battery safety. Along with your pizza, look for flyers with top fire safety tips, including:

  • INSTALL smoke alarms on every level of your home, inside bedrooms, and outside sleeping areas.
  • TEST smoke alarms monthly using the test button.
  • REPLACE smoke alarms every 10 years or if they’re no longer working.

Why Fire Safety Matters

According to NFPA, the majority of U.S. home fire deaths occur at home. Properly functioning smoke alarms give you the precious time needed to escape in an emergency.
